English Abstract
Alumina one of the ceramic materials has high hardness, chromia has a stability in corrosive media.
These properties promote to prepare ceramic- ceramic nano composite from them.
In this study, nano composite powder from alumina/chromia at (2,6,10,15,20 wt%) chromia, was prepared using modified sol-gel technique.
Solution with 0.5 M from each aluminum nitrates and chromium nitrates were used with 50/50 ratio of ethanol/water as solvent solution at room temperature.
Furthermore, glucose with 7 % was used as surfactant material.
Calcination temperature 600cc was used after getting the gel.
Several tests such as thermogravimetry-differential thermal analysis, energy-dispersive X-ray spectroscopy, X-ray diffraction, transmission electron microscope, and scanning electron microscope for the prepared calcined powder.
Entering at 1250cc,1450cc and 1650cc has been done for one hour to the formed samples.
After sintering, physical properties, such as apparent density, porosity and water absorption, have been measured.
Microstructure examination after sintering is revealed by scanning electron microscope, light optical microscope, X-ray diffraction and energy-dispersive X-ray spectroscopy has also been studied.
Vickers micro hardness and Brazilian test have also been conducted as mechanical properties for all samples.
It is clear that the average particle size for composite with 15 wt% chromia sample is 4.5nm by using transmission electron microscope technique after calcinations at 600cc for two hours.
After sintering at 1650cc for one hour, the composite specimen with 20% chromia has 4.2 g/cm3 apparent density, apparent porosity was 10%.
The maximum Vickers hardness for prepared composite with 15 % chromia sample at 1650cc for one hour is 1473 MPa.
Whereas, the highest tensile strength for Brazilian test is 19.7 MPa for same sample and at same conditions.
